The **Gaming Marketing Manager** reports directly to the General Manager Marketing, and is responsible for managing all Sydney gaming campaigns, promotions and other strategic initiatives designed to drive gaming visitation, revenue and ROMI for our guests.

This is a fantastic opportunity where you can lead your team and together create exciting campaigns for The Star.

**A few of your responsibilities**:

- Be the key property lead for all gaming marketing activities and planning
- Manage and support Marketing Executive team members
- Management of the overall return on marketing investment, activity planning and key stakeholder engagement
- Work with the General Manager, Marketing in engaging the Customer Insights, Analytics and Commercial Finance team on the impact of activity via post implementation reviews
- Develop offers for relevant segments (promotional copy, rules and restrictions, legal review, customer service and property operations review, etc.) and develop and monitor success at program, customer, and campaign level

**What we are looking for**:

- Demonstrated experience in marketing, advertising, or brand development, as well people management
- You will be motivated by people and achieving the best outcomes for your customers
- Ability to work in a fast paced and ever-changing environment
- Strong communication skills to confidently liaise with and manage expectations and demands of stakeholders
- Tertiary degree in Business, Marketing or a related work experience
